#192d20 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#192d20 is composed of 9.8% red, 17.6%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.9% yellow and 82.4% black. It has a hue angle of 141 degrees, a saturation of 28.6% and a lightness of 13.7%. #192d20 color hex could be obtained by blending #325a40 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#192d20

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040705 is the darkest color, while #fafc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#192d20

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#212522 is the less saturated color, while #014519 is the most saturated one.
